An electric vehicle includes a battery modules electrically connected in parallel and having the same nominal module voltage, a determination device for determining a battery state parameter representing a state of charge of the battery module; a switching system to switch current paths of the battery modules to be conducting or blocking; an energy management system configured to, if a battery module has a state of charge that is noticeably lower than a state of charge of another battery modules, switch the current path of the battery module with the lower state of charge to be blocking during a driving mode until the charging state of the battery module with the higher state of charge is balanced with the charge state of the battery module with the lower state of charge, and then switch the current path of the battery module with the lower state of charge to be conductive.
